Resumo

This paper presents the numerical simulation of the circumfluence of a recovery apparatus with brake engines and a detachable heat protection shield carried out by the use of the conservative numerical method of cluster architecture. The simulation results of the action of reactive jets of brake engines on the landing surface and the recovery apparatus, as well as the basic aerodynamic characteristics, are considered.
